How can I apply for a work permit for foreigners in Colombia?
To apply for a work permit for foreigners in Colombia, you must meet the requirements established by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and the Colombian Foreign Ministry. This may include the presentation of documents such as a valid passport, criminal record certificates, certificates of physical and mental fitness, offer of employment by a Colombian company, and compliance with the specific requirements for the category of work permit to which you apply. . You must submit the application to the Colombian Consulate in your country of residence and follow the indicated steps.
What is the crime of alienation of property in Mexican criminal law?
The crime of alienation of property in Mexican criminal law refers to the illegal transfer of ownership of movable or immovable property, without the consent or knowledge of the legitimate owner, in order to obtain an illicit economic benefit, and is punishable by penalties that They range from fines to imprisonment, depending on the value of the assets sold and the circumstances of the crime.
